怎么用一个指针数组指向一个数组?比如:int a[]={1,2,3},*p[3];怎么指向?

来源:学生作业帮助网 编辑:作业帮 时间:2024/04/28 01:19:15

怎么用一个指针数组指向一个数组?比如:int a[]={1,2,3},*p[3];怎么指向?
怎么用一个指针数组指向一个数组?比如:int a[]={1,2,3},*p[3];怎么指向?

怎么用一个指针数组指向一个数组?比如:int a[]={1,2,3},*p[3];怎么指向?
#include
void main()
{
int a[]={1,2,3},*p[3];
p[0]=&a[0];
p[1]=&a[1];
p[2]=&a[2];
printf("%d %d %d ",*p[0],*p[1],*p[2]);
}

怎么用一个指针数组指向一个数组?比如:int a[]={1,2,3},*p[3];怎么指向? 如果指针指向一个数组,如何随机访问其指向的数组元素?说具体点 如何定义一个函数 返回一个指向数组的指针 定义一个指针变量,使它指向数组的第一个元素?怎么实现? 输入10个实数,存入一维数组,输出其中的最大值、最小值和平均值.要求用指向数组的指针变量来处理数组元这是我写的,怎么错误了?帮我重新写一个,void main(){float a[10],*p=a,*q,*max,*min,pj=0,i=0,j;for 怎么定义指向三维数组的指针想定义一个指针p,double,分配空间为 new double[13][15][3]最终考虑到返回指针p 如何定义指针数组指向文件夹中的图片?想遍历文件夹中的图片,写入一个视频设备,不知道用C语言怎么写? 怎么定义一个数组 C 写一个函数,接收三个长度相等的浮点型数组,将前两个数组的对应元素加在一起放入第三个数组对应元素中,函数的返回值指向第三个数组的指针.本人小白, “指针的类型是指向数组元素的指针”如何理解?徐惠民主编的《C++大学基础教程》第6章指针与引用p136有这么一句话:“指针的类型是指向数组元素的指针.数组名也是数组第一个元素的地址 c++error C2018:unknown character '0xa1'1.用指针法输入9个数存入一维数组x中;2.再用指针法输入1个待插入的数存入y变量中;3.在第4步循环之前,将指向数组的指针px向数组头部位置退回一个元素 C++ 设计一个通用的插入排序函数,参数为指向实数的指针(指向一个已安排好序的数组),和一个实数,将该 用C语言在主函数中定义和初始化一个二维数组a[3][4]和一个指针数组,采用指针数组去访问数组元素a[2][4]; 用C语言在主函数中定义和初始化一个二维数组a[3][4]和一个指针数组,采用指针数组去访问数组元素a[2][4] 用一个循环数组q m 表示队列,队列元素均为字符型.假设该队列只有头指针front,头指针指向当前列队首元素用一个循环数组q[m]表示队列,队列元素均为字符型.假设该队列只有头指针front,头指针 定义一个函数,函数的参数为一维数组(用指针表示)函数返回数组元素平均值 (函数、数组)编写求N个数的最大值函数和最小值函数.一位数组和二维数组各写一个程序,不需要用指针. 用指针创建一个数组,将数组中0的都移到数组末尾,将非零的移至开始(保持原来的顺序不变).